New Graduate Engineer, Electrical - Satellites (Starlink)
SpaceX · Redmond, WA · 3 wk ago
On-siteEngineeringFull-time
Responsibilities
- Rapidly develop high-reliability electronics for satellites and spacecraft.
- Drive system trades, requirements capture, component selection, analysis, schematic capture, PCB layout, prototyping, hardware bring-up, debugging, documentation, manufacturing, test, and on-orbit performance of complex electrical designs.
- Get hands-on and support hardware through production, satellite integration, and flight.
- Work closely with engineers from adjacent disciplines (mechanical, thermal, software, test engineering, supply chain, silicon design, etc.) to deliver tightly integrated, high-performance hardware.
- Challenge assumptions, question requirements, learn from your mistakes, and approach problems with an open mind.
BASIC QUALIFICATIONS
- B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ering, computer engineering, physics, or another STEM discipline.
- 1+ years of experience design/analysis of circuits, electronic products, or hardware (internships/co-ops and club projects can apply).
- Graduating in the spring of 2026 or summer of 2026.
PREFERRED S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E
- Master’s degree in electrical engineering, computer engineering, or similar engineering degree.
- Electronic product experience designing hardware from concept through production; strong emphasis on full life-cycle development of new hardware products and not small incremental updates to legacy hardware.
- Experience designing and implementing mixed-signal circuit boards from concept through production using processors, FPGAs, Ethernet, multi-GHz Serdes, DRAM interfaces (DDR4), I2C, SPI, RF/mm, operational amplifiers, analog to digital and digital to analog converters, and power supply components.
- Experience testing, troubleshooting, and debugging electronics.
- Strong understanding of computers and programming languages (Python, C/C++).
- Demonstrated ability to work in a highly cross-functional role.
- Experience working on space grade hardware.
